56 /* This function scans a C source file (actually, the output of cpp),
57    reading from FP.  It looks for function declarations, and
58    external variable declarations.  
59
60    The following grammar (as well as some extra stuff) is recognized:
61
62    declaration:
63      (decl-specifier)* declarator ("," declarator)* ";"
64    decl-specifier:
65      identifier
66      keyword
67      extern "C"
68    declarator:
69      (ptr-operator)* dname [ "(" argument-declaration-list ")" ]
70    ptr-operator:
71      ("*" | "&") ("const" | "volatile")*
72    dname:
73      identifier
74
75 Here dname is the actual name being declared.
76 */
